Rates and thresholds

The expressions above read these as $const. They are the figures the annual refresh replaces, so they live as data rather than being written into the formulas — which is what makes a year-on-year change a one-line diff instead of an edit to arithmetic.

ConstantValue
rateKA0.18
rateDL0.07
rateTN0.13
rateMH0.11

Test vectors (3)

Every case is executed against this model on each build, by the Java engine and independently by a JavaScript one. A mismatch of a single cent fails the build, so the page cannot ship advertising a figure the model no longer produces.

Case 1 — C1 Karnataka, ex-showroom ₹1,200,000 at 18%

given exShowroom1200000
given stateKA
expect roadTax216000

Case 2 — C2 Delhi, ex-showroom ₹800,000 at 7%

given exShowroom800000
given stateDL
expect roadTax56000

Case 3 — C3 Tamil Nadu, ex-showroom 1,000,000 at 13%

given exShowroom1000000
given stateTN
expect rate0.13
expect roadTax130000
